What are the primary benefits of using tannic acid in skincare products?
Tannic acid offers several benefits for the skin due to its natural antiseptic and astringent properties. In skincare products, it helps reduce bacterial growth, making it effective in treating acne and soothing skin irritations. Furthermore, tannic acid acts as an antioxidant, protecting the skin from free radicals that lead to premature aging. It also tightens pores, reduces redness, and minimizes the appearance of fine lines and wrinkles, contributing to a more youthful and refined complexion.
How can tannic acid benefit hair care?
Tannic acid contributes positively to hair care by reducing frizz and flyaways, resulting in smoother and more polished hair. Its astringent qualities help manage excess oil in the scalp, promoting a balanced and healthy scalp environment. Additionally, tannic acid can stimulate hair growth by enhancing blood circulation to the scalp, creating favorable conditions for healthy hair follicles.
Are there any precautions to consider when using products containing tannic acid?
Yes, there are important precautions to consider when using products with tannic acid, particularly for those with sensitive skin. Tannic acid can be irritating, so it is crucial to use these products in moderation. A patch test should always be conducted before full application to ensure there is no adverse reaction. If you experience any irritation or discomfort, it is advisable to discontinue use and consult a dermatologist.
In what types of products is tannic acid commonly found?
Tannic acid is commonly found in various cosmetic products, particularly those designed for skincare. It is often included in skincare creams, soaps, and aftershave balms due to its astringent and preservative properties. These products utilize tannic acid to help tighten pores, reduce redness, and provide an overall soothing effect on the skin.
